Approvals — Swiftfinch autocomplete index. Symptom: suggestion latency above 400ms, usually after bulk catalog imports. First step: check the Reedmere index-lag dashboard. If lag exceeds 10 minutes, a reindex is warranted. Reindexing is disruptive — search quality degrades during the rebuild — so it requires explicit approval, no exceptions, even off-hours. Partial reindex of hot shards is allowed with the same approval. Document the trigger and timing in the on-call log. Approval authority rests with the engineer named below.

account owner for bawip-tahag: Raleth Quenok

## 2.14.3 — Key rotation

- Rotated signing credentials for the Quarto tile-rendering cache layer per quarterly policy.
- Old key revoked at cutover; all artifacts built after build 4812 must verify against the new key.
- Edge purge completed; no stale-tile reports.
- Verification step added to the promote script; promotion now fails closed on mismatch.
- Rollbacks to pre-4812 builds require re-signing — ping release eng first.

For pipeline configuration, the current deploy key is as follows.

signing key of bagap-yawep = bky13_TbfT6ZMUoGJo2

## Sensor drift: what to do at 3am

If the GrowLoop controller starts reporting humidity swings that don't match the backup probes in the Fernwick greenhouse, it's almost always sensor drift, not an actual climate event. Don't panic and don't touch the vents manually. First, restart the calibration daemon and give it ten minutes to re-baseline. If readings still disagree by more than 5%, flip the controller into safe mode. The safe-mode thresholds it will use are these.

config for yahap-bajof:
[istix]
host = istix.qorvelsys.internal
user = istix_svc
database = istix_prod